CHWY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

439 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Chewy (CHWY)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$33.8B — down 6.3% from $36.1B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 89 funds closed out of CHWY and 76 opened new positions — a net loss of 13 holders — while 145 trimmed existing stakes and 153 added.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$219M. The largest seller was Macquarie Group, cutting an estimated $128M.
